Australian inflation has eased slightly, reducing the likelihood of an interest rate rise in August. The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A) will now face a more nuanced decision-making process as it weighs the broader economic landscape, including global oil price fluctuations and domestic labor market dynamics. The Australian Bureau of Statistics (ABS) reported that consumer price inflation rose 3.8% in the year to June 2026, down from 4.0% in the year to May. The RBA’s preferred measure of underlying inflation, the trimmed mean, remained stable at 3.6%. This metric, which excludes extreme price changes, indicates that core inflation pressures persist, albeit at a slower pace than previously anticipated. These figures represent the most critical economic data the RBA will review before its next policy meeting on August 10–11. The easing inflation data has significantly altered market expectations. Financial markets have slashed the probability of an August rate hike to nearly zero, reflecting confidence that the RBA may choose to maintain the current interest rate. However, analysts warn that the central bank may still consider a final rate increase later in the year should inflation risks resurge. The RBA has already raised the cash rate three times this year, each in February, March, and May, as part of its effort to bring inflation back within its target range of 2–3%. Since June, several factors have contributed to the shift in inflation trends. Housing costs remained a dominant contributor, rising 6.8% annually, while food and non-alcoholic beverage prices and transportation expenses also played a role. Notably, the largest monthly decline occurred in automotive fuel prices, as global oil prices dipped. Despite these improvements, services inflation persisted, particularly in rent-related categories, suggesting that underlying domestic price pressures have not entirely abated. The global context has also evolved significantly since the last inflation report. Recent escalations in the conflict involving Iran have pushed oil prices back above US$100 a barrel, creating new inflation risks that were not captured in the June data. This fluctuation highlights the uncertainty surrounding future inflation trajectories, as the RBA must balance immediate data with forward-looking assessments. Labor market conditions have also influenced the RBA’s considerations. Employment figures for June revealed a stronger-than-expected increase of 76,300 jobs, reinforcing the resilience of the labor market. This provides the RBA with greater flexibility to prioritize inflation control over maintaining robust employment growth. Over the past two years, Australia has experienced a marked transformation in its inflation profile. Broad-based inflation following the pandemic has eased as supply chains stabilized and higher interest rates curbed demand. Trimmed mean inflation, currently at 3.6%, is substantially lower than the post-pandemic peak of 6.8% in December 2022. Persistent price pressures remain concentrated in service sectors such as rents, insurance, and healthcare, where inflation has proven more stubborn. Higher oil prices continue to pose a threat to inflation stability. Global energy markets have shown dramatic shifts recently, with oil prices briefly surpassing US$100 a barrel. Such increases affect more than just fuel costs, they drive up transport, freight, and production expenses across the economy. Businesses often pass these additional costs onto consumers, thereby exerting upward pressure on inflation. Although Australia is less vulnerable to oil shocks than in the past, sustained prices above US$100 would still complicate the inflation outlook. Unlike demand-driven inflation, this type of inflation is a supply shock that interest rates alone cannot directly counteract. RBA Governor Michele Bullock reiterated that inflation is still too high, emphasizing the central bank’s commitment to bringing it back within its target range. She stated the RBA is prepared to act as required, including by raising the cash rate further if necessary. This stance underscores the delicate balancing act the RBA faces as it navigates evolving economic conditions. Meanwhile, the Australian government has expressed cautious optimism. Treasurer Jim Chalmers acknowledged the slight reduction in inflation, noting that it is below the forecasts of both his department and the RBA. However, he cautioned against complacency, highlighting the ongoing risks posed by potential oil price spikes and geopolitical tensions. Chalmers emphasized the importance of maintaining fiscal discipline, particularly as the government considers measures to alleviate the cost-of-living burden on households and businesses. The government has also faced scrutiny regarding its approach to managing inflation. Independent economist Chris Richardson pointed out that while the government has avoided some of the worst inflation scenarios, it remains exposed to external risks, including the volatile state of Middle Eastern politics. Additionally, Richardson questioned whether the government might feel emboldened to pursue expansionary fiscal policies if inflation continues to ease, potentially exacerbating inflationary pressures. The RBA’s challenge extends beyond inflation management to include addressing long-standing issues such as weak productivity growth. Governor Bullock highlighted that persistently low productivity growth has weighed on real incomes and economic growth for many years. Boosting productivity requires a multifaceted approach, involving numerous practical reforms rather than a single solution. This complexity adds to the central bank’s difficulty in crafting an effective monetary policy response. Domestically, the RBA’s decision-making process is further complicated by the public’s limited understanding of how monetary policy functions. A recent survey conducted by the RBA found that only 25% of respondents correctly identified that higher interest rates help reduce inflation. Many believed that higher rates would increase inflation, reflecting a misunderstanding of the mechanism through which monetary policy influences the economy. This knowledge gap poses challenges for the RBA as it seeks to communicate its strategy effectively to the public. Internationally, the U.S. Federal Reserve has also faced mounting pressure to adjust its monetary policy. Fed Chair Kevin Warsh has maintained a firm stance on controlling inflation, asserting that the U.S. inflation rate has remained above the 2% target for over five years. However, the Fed’s reluctance to provide clear guidance has led to market speculation and increased volatility. Long-term bond yields have surged, with the 30-year yield reaching its highest level since 2007. This reflects growing investor concerns about the Fed’s commitment to tackling inflation, despite its assertions of vigilance. The political climate in the U.S. has added another layer of complexity to the Fed’s operations. President Donald Trump has intensified his calls for rate cuts, aligning with his previous campaign promises. His administration has pursued politically motivated actions against former Fed officials, aiming to reshape the composition of the Fed’s board. These developments have placed the Fed in a precarious position, caught between its mandate to manage inflation and the political pressures exerted by the executive branch. As the RBA prepares for its next policy meeting, the path forward remains uncertain. While the immediate likelihood of an August rate hike appears minimal, the central bank must remain vigilant in monitoring both domestic and international economic indicators. The interplay between inflation, labor market strength, and global commodity prices will continue to shape the RBA’s decisions in the coming months.
